Common Mistakes When Using Massage Logo Design 15

While Massage Logo Design 15 is a great resource, there are several common mistakes users may make when using it. Understanding these can help you avoid unnecessary errors and ensure your final logo is both effective and visually appealing.

Overlooking Font Licensing: Many users assume that because the font is free, it's automatically safe to use. However, some free fonts come with restrictions. Always check the font’s license agreement before using it in your logo.

Ignoring Color Compatibility: While the template offers a range of color options, not all colors work well together. Poor color combinations can make your logo appear unprofessional or difficult to read. Use tools like color pickers or online color generators to find the best pairings.

Not Using Mockups Properly: The mockups provided in the template are for presentation purposes only. They should not be used as part of the final design. Instead, focus on the core elements of the logo and test it across different mediums and sizes.

Underestimating the Importance of Branding: A logo is more than just a visual element—it’s a representation of your brand. Ensure that the design aligns with your overall branding strategy, including your mission, values, and target audience.

What to Check Before Finalizing Your Logo

Before finalizing your logo, there are several key factors to consider:

  1. Clarity: Ensure that your logo is legible at different sizes and in various formats.
  2. Originality: Check for similar logos to avoid duplication and ensure your design stands out.
  3. Scalability: Test the logo in different resolutions to confirm it maintains quality and clarity.
  4. Brand Alignment: Make sure the design reflects your brand’s personality and values.
  5. Legal Compliance: Verify that all assets used are legally permissible for commercial use.

By taking these steps, you can ensure that your logo not only meets your design goals but also supports your business objectives.
